Cell-, tissue-, and position-specific monoclonal antibodies against the planarian Dugesia (Girardia) tigrina

Abstract: To obtain specific immunological probes for studying molecular mechanisms involved in cell renewal, cell differentiation, and pattern formation in intact and regenerating planarians, we have produced a hybridoma library specific for the asexual race of the fresh-water planarian Dugesia (Girardia) tigrina. Among the 276 monoclonal antibodies showing tissue-, cell-, cell subtype-, subcellular- and position-specific staining, we have found monoclonal antibodies against all tissues and cell types with the exceptio… Show more

“…The planarian gastrodermis is a monostratified epithelium composed of two cell types, absorptive phagocytes and secretory goblet cells, surrounded by an enteric muscular plexus (Bowen et al, 1974;Bueno et al, 1997;Kobayashi et al, 1998). To better characterize the loss of the gut after egfr-1 RNAi, we performed a detailed histological analysis of the gastrodermis.…”

“…Compared to other model organisms, available antibodies against planarian cells are scarce and directed against intracellular epitopes. Moreover, none has been described to be specific for pASCs so far (Bueno et al, 1997). It is conceivable that different planarian cell types also differ in their cell surface epitopes, which is why we opted for generating a library of mouse monoclonal antibodies against the planarian membrane proteome.…”

“…6 Although neoblasts and some differentiated cells can be partially purified and cultured in vitro for some weeks, 24,25 no stable cell line has yet been developed. Some monoclonal antibodies have been produced that serve as molecular markers in planarian 26,27 and similarly, the first genes that may be candidates to control the process of regeneration have been amplified and cloned. 28,29 Although the work carried out on planarians was intense during those years, planarians have always been overshadowed by other model organisms in which gene function can be studied through the use of gain-and/or loss-of-function mutants.…”
